About this property

Perched in an elevated Perth Hills position where views stretch across the city and the world below feels far away, this architecturally-designed home is a masterclass in timeless living. Nestled within a peaceful loop street, this single-level residence embraces a philosophy of simplicity - crafted with local materials, designed for the climate, and built to endure rather than follow fleeting trends. Flexible and functional, the three-bedroom, two-bathroom layout is complemented by a home office and a versatile fourth-bedroom option - equally suited as a studio, sewing room, or guest space. A generous double garage, extensive under-house storage, and a pergola round out a package that is as practical as it is beautiful. The private master suite - with its own ensuite, walk-in robe, and balcony - is thoughtfully positioned at the opposite end of the home to the minor bedrooms, with generous living spaces flowing between. Multiple decks, verandahs, and balconies draped in bougainvillea invite you outdoors at every turn, where breathtaking panoramic views across the Swan Coastal Plain stretch as far as the eye can see. Whether from the kitchen sink, the living room, or waking up in the master suite, the view is an ever-present companion - framed beautifully by the home's signature timber-lined ceilings and warm hardwood joinery that give it its unmistakable character. Bordering Mundy Regional Park - home to the spectacular Lesmurdie Falls, the iconic Bibbulmun Track, and breathtaking wildflower displays each spring - yet minutes from Kalamunda Central's vibrant café and dining scene. Families are also well-served with quality schooling nearby, including Kalamunda Senior High School, St Brigid's College, and Mazenod College. A home where style, space, and seclusion coexist - this is hills living at its very best.
